Object description
A business estate with special site offers for all kinds of logistic service providers (haulage firms, wholesale warehouses, service providers and firms operating in the service sector) as well as for the wholesale sector.
Site owner
Municipality / municipalities
Comments on the ownership structure
The proprietor of the freight village (German: GVZ) sites is the OBG - Osnabrücker Beteiligungs- und Grundstücksentwicklungsgesellschaft mbH (Osnabrück Investment and Real Estate Development Company) and the Stdtwerke Osnabrücl AG (Osnabrück public utility company), both wholly-owned subsidiaries of the City of Osnabrück. Marketing of the OBG sites is being solely carried out by the WFO Wirtschaftsförderung Osnabrück GmbH (the Osnabrück Economic Development Company) on behalf of the OBG.

Comment on the transport infrastructure
Osnabrück lies on the intersection of transcontinental traffic axes in the North-South and East-West directions and thus links the urban agglomerations of Hamburg and Rhein/Ruhr as well as Berlin and Hannover with Randstaad in Holland.
